> When calling rte_eal_cleanup, the mp channel cleanup routine only sets
> mp_fd to -1 leaving the rte_mp_handle control thread running.
> This control thread can spew warnings on reading on an invalid fd.
>
> To handle this situation, sets mp_fd to -1 to signal the control thread
> it should exit, but since this thread might be sleeping on the socket,
> cancel the thread too.
